----A recent study from the University of Copenhagen has uncovered a remarkable truth: every blue-eyed person on Earth shares a common ancestor who lived between 6,000 and 10,000 years ago. This scientific discovery not only sheds light on the origin of blue eyes but also reveals how a small genetic mutation spread across generations, affecting millions of people worldwide.----
